Parks Group Charter Alert: Community Boards Threatened

In an essay they call “The Five Cs,” the concerned New Yorkers who head the parks advocacy organization, “250+ Friends of Parks,” remind our readers about the possibility that a charter revision this year could try to eliminate community boards. Our own take is that ultimately, a Bloomberg 2010 charter revision commission will not move to eliminate community boards entirely, but can be expected to propose changes that will limit their scope or effectiveness.
